黑狐家游戏

分布式文档存储原理,分布式文档存储,原理、挑战与创新

欧气 0 0

本文目录导读:

  1. 分布式文档存储原理
  2. 分布式文档存储的挑战
  3. 分布式文档存储的创新

随着互联网技术的飞速发展,数据量呈爆炸式增长,传统的文档存储方式已无法满足海量数据的存储需求,分布式文档存储作为一种新兴的存储技术,以其高效、可靠、可扩展等优势,成为解决海量数据存储难题的重要手段,本文将深入探讨分布式文档存储的原理、挑战与创新,以期为大家提供有益的参考。

分布式文档存储原理

1、分布式存储架构

分布式文档存储采用分布式存储架构,将数据分散存储在多个节点上,每个节点负责存储一部分数据,并通过网络相互连接,形成一个庞大的存储系统,这种架构具有以下优点:

分布式文档存储原理,分布式文档存储,原理、挑战与创新

图片来源于网络,如有侵权联系删除

(1)提高数据可靠性:通过数据冗余,即使某个节点出现故障,也不会影响数据的完整性。

(2)提高数据访问速度:用户可以就近访问数据,降低网络延迟。

(3)提高系统可扩展性:随着数据量的增长,可以随时增加节点,提高系统存储容量。

2、数据分片

分布式文档存储将数据按照一定的规则进行分片,每个分片存储在特定的节点上,分片策略有多种,如范围分片、哈希分片等,哈希分片是最常用的分片策略,通过哈希函数将数据映射到不同的节点上。

3、数据一致性

分布式文档存储需要保证数据一致性,即多个节点上的数据保持一致,一致性算法有多种,如Paxos算法、Raft算法等,这些算法通过一系列的协议和机制,确保数据在多个节点上的一致性。

4、数据副本

分布式文档存储原理,分布式文档存储,原理、挑战与创新

图片来源于网络,如有侵权联系删除

为了提高数据可靠性,分布式文档存储通常采用数据副本机制,将数据在多个节点上存储多个副本,当某个节点出现故障时,可以从其他节点恢复数据。

分布式文档存储的挑战

1、数据一致性问题

分布式文档存储面临的一大挑战是数据一致性,由于分布式环境下的网络延迟、节点故障等因素,数据一致性难以保证,如何设计高效、可靠的一致性算法,成为分布式文档存储领域的研究热点。

2、数据分区问题

数据分区是分布式文档存储的另一个挑战,如何将数据合理地分配到各个节点上,既要保证数据访问速度,又要避免某个节点过载,是一个需要解决的问题。

3、系统可扩展性问题

随着数据量的不断增长,分布式文档存储系统需要具备良好的可扩展性,如何设计高效、可扩展的分布式存储架构,成为分布式文档存储领域的研究难点。

分布式文档存储的创新

1、基于区块链的分布式文档存储

分布式文档存储原理,分布式文档存储,原理、挑战与创新

图片来源于网络,如有侵权联系删除

区块链技术具有去中心化、安全性高、不可篡改等特点,近年来被广泛应用于分布式文档存储领域,基于区块链的分布式文档存储可以有效解决数据一致性问题,提高数据安全性。

2、基于人工智能的分布式文档存储

人工智能技术在分布式文档存储领域具有广泛的应用前景,通过人工智能技术,可以实现智能数据分区、智能副本管理等,提高分布式文档存储系统的效率和可靠性。

3、分布式文档存储与边缘计算的融合

随着物联网、5G等技术的发展,边缘计算逐渐成为趋势,将分布式文档存储与边缘计算相结合,可以实现数据在边缘节点的存储和处理,降低数据传输成本,提高数据访问速度。

分布式文档存储作为一种新兴的存储技术,具有高效、可靠、可扩展等优势,分布式文档存储仍面临数据一致性、数据分区、系统可扩展性等挑战,随着区块链、人工智能等技术的发展,分布式文档存储将不断创新,为海量数据存储提供有力支持。

标签: #分布式文档存储

黑狐家游戏
  • 评论列表

留言评论